the actual FOAMING comes from the mechanism itself, you'll see in this bottle & in other hand-soap foaming bottles that the pump top has an extra component that the other bottles do not, that's the piece that causes the FOAMING. ---the alcohol helps with streaking but is not needed, however, it might also help as a disinfectant on surfaces & in your hand soap.

I'm a professional cleaner and this is what I do. 30mls / 1oz of 99% isopropyl alcohol and 45mls /1.5 oz of Dawn Platinum and the rest water. I do still keep real Powerwash in my kit and use it in lieu of a heavy duty degreaser or oven cleaner but this homemade stuff I use on everything. I even premix the alcohol & Dawn in the bottles and keep in my kit and then add the water onsite to keep weight down. I use 1-2 to 3/4 bottle a day so the savings really adds up.

I mix one part dawn, three parts vinegar and three parts water to make the best shower cleaner I’ve ever used. The vinegar cuts the body oils and soap/shampoo and the dawn is a surfactant/grease cutter. I got this from the net years ago and it works beautifully.

🌸There's denatured alcohol in Dawn PowerWash, the Denatured is a solvent that is the secret ingredient that's makes the difference in the cleaning Power. It is different from regular isopropyl alcohol. You video is a great alternative, thank you Sir. 🙏
Denatured alcohol is just Ethyl alcohol with a lot of foul tasting ingredients added so that people won't drink it. Ethyl alcohol is the alcohol that we consume - i.e. Vodka.
